A lot! That’s something that makes our studio so unique and we cater to both photographers with advanced lighting experience and those who have none.
For natural light photographers with little to no lighting experience, our studio provides soft natural window light with available aide of continuous lighting to ensure images can be captured with ease.
For photographers with advanced lighting experience, our studio has been designed to give creatives full lighting control and provides access to a wide range of lighting capabilities from blackout panels for the windows, V-Flats, gels/masks and so much more.

Maintaining a clean and safe environment is super important to us. In addition to regular cleaning and availability to hand sanitizer provided in the studio, a 30-minute buffer is placed between each rental to allow time for our staff to vacumn and sanitize. For hard surface items, like table tops and touch props, items are cleaned with Clorox wipes. For fabric surfaces like couches, client closet items, and blankets, items are sprayed throughly with Lysol spray between each use.

Yes! If you are staging your own set, please be sure to include enough time in your rental before your session starts for setting up and after your session for tearing down. For simple setups we normally recommend adding a half hour at the beginning and end of your session, and for more complex ones, an hour to two hours before and after your session start and end times. While we have some buffer room inbetween rentals, this timeframe is used by our staff to tidy, vacuum, clean, and sanitize before the next rental, so please do your best to ensure you are fully done by the end of your rental time.

We understand that flexibility is key.
Rental Fees Paid. To provide consideration for the time pulled from our calendar, rental fees paid will not be refunded, regardless of circumstance, but we do allow for flexible rescheduling or cancellation with issuance of a gift card when advance notice is provided.
Options. If you need to reschedule or cancel, you have the option to:
Reschedule. To reschedule, you can use the rescheduling link at the bottom of your confirmation or reminder email.
Cancel & Have a Gift Card Issued. To cancel and have a gift card issued, simply respond to your email confirmation/reminder.
These options are available as long as you are within the timeframes available for changes below.
Timeframe Available for Changes. The timeframe available for changes (rescheduling or cancelling with issuance of a gift card) varies based on the amount of time that has been blocked out of our calendar to hold your date and time.
30-Minute, 1 Hour & 2 Hour Rentals. Can be rescheduled/canceled with issuance of gift card up to 2 hours in advance.
3-Hour & 4-Hour Rentals. Can be rescheduled/canceled with issuance of gift card up to one day in advance.
5-Hour & 6-Hour Rentals. Can be rescheduled/canceled with issuance of gift card up to two days in advance.
7-Hour & 8-Hour Rentals. Can be rescheduled/canceled with issuance of gift carde up to one week in advance.
Event & Bridal Suite Rentals. Please refer to your contract details for exact rescheduling/cancellation options.
Timeframe When Rentals are Locked in Place. As there is very little chance of reopening dates for booking once the timeframes below have been reached, rentals are ineligible for changes to date or time at the timeframes listed below. This means that the rental timeslot will remain reserved and available for you to use, and no gift card will be issued even if you do not use the space.
30-Minute, 1 Hour & 2 Hour Rentals. 2 hours before your rental start time.
3-Hour & 4-Hour Rentals. 24 hours before your rental start time.
5-Hour & 6-Hour Rentals. 48 hours before your rental start time.
7-Hour & 8-Hour Rentals. One week before your rental start time.
Event & Bridal Suite Rentals. Please refer to your contract details for exact rescheduling/cancellation options.
